http://ultimatefishingsite.net/vilas-county-wi-fishing/bittersweet-lakes-state-natural-area/ WebThe lakes are Bittersweet (104 acres, 31 feet), Oberlin (46 acres, 25 feet), Smith (43 acres, 18 feet), and Prong (30 acres, 50 feet), and all have a variety of bottom substrates, ranging from sand and gravel to rock and muck, are slightly acidic, and have relatively high water clarity. Water levels fluctuate slightly each year.

http://ultimatefishingsite.net/vilas-county-wi-fishing/the-fish/largemouth-bass/ WebBittersweet Lakes State Natural Area Four soft water seepage lakes, each separated by an isthmus are the main features of the natural area. The lakes are Bittersweet, Oberlin, Smith and Prong. The lakes offer good fishing, especially for panfish and largemouth bass.
